    Craig A.

A versatile desktop for more common computing tasks

  • November 30, 2021
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
The UI has come along way to help the migration of Windows centric users feel at home on a non windows OS. The productivity applications are getting comprehensive too.
What do you dislike about the product?
The patching process can still be cumbersome to automate and control to the same level as Windows Operating Systems. Antivirus offerings can also be more limited than Windows or Mac offerings.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
We quickly needed to redeploy our backlog of older laptops with a standardized and supported Operating System at the start of 2020 to some of our employees. The organization required this in response to the Covid 19 lockdowns and many users not having suitable hardware in their homes. It is important to note most of our business and productivity apps are SaaS-delivered, so we had limited to no issues with application compatibility.


    Kaleb-John L.

Good for all your DevOps needs

  • November 27, 2021
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
Ubuntu Server is free and customizable. This means that it is suited to satisfy most needs. Ubuntu Server supports many commonly used software, which can be used to quickly set up anything from a web server to a local network storage system. It is simple to deploy on any piece of hardware or within a virtual machine.
What do you dislike about the product?
There are a variety of supported versions of Ubuntu Server. While this is typically not an issue due to the level of community support, there can be times where a certain configuration or software does not work as well on one version of Ubuntu as it would another. This can lead to issues where you have a system that half works perfectly on one version and half works perfectly on another version.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
I utilize Ubuntu Server for many different purposes. Primarily, I use it to develop, test, and deploy various web servers, but I have also used it as a local network storage management system. I often use it to test Docker images that provide easy to deploy services that I want to evaluate.

    Peter T.

Budget friendly OS that packs a punch

  • November 23, 2021
  • Review provided by G2

What do you like best about the product?
Ubuntu is flexible, customizable, fast and light weight as compared to some other systems. Ubuntu is easy to install, easy to maintain. It can easily integrate with other softwares and if it can't the. there is always a version of it or software be ran thru wine.
What do you dislike about the product?
Users need to be very familiar with Unix or else it will be hard to get around the system. The OS GUI is still a bit clunky. Typically I always customize the graphical interface to meet my needs.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
Ubuntu solves my budget and tuning cost. I can run web servers, report servers and database systems without much complications. Of course everything still ties to the underlying hardware but if I need to deploy on production mode then I can always move the OS image to a VM that has powerful specs. Another great benefit to running Ubuntu is that it is already Unix based so running or converting tools from other Unix based OS is not that hard.
